How to Connect Muze Bluetooth Headphones?
To connect your Muze Bluetooth headphones, follow these simple steps:
- Turn on your Muze headphones and ensure that they are in pairing mode.
- On your device, go to the Bluetooth settings and turn on Bluetooth.
- Select the Muze headphones from the list of available devices.
- Once connected, you should hear a confirmation sound from your headphones.
That’s it! You have successfully connected your Muze Bluetooth headphones to your device.

Step 1: Turn on Bluetooth
The first step in connecting your Muze Bluetooth headphones is to make sure that Bluetooth is turned on your device. This can be done by going to the settings menu and selecting Bluetooth. Once you have turned on Bluetooth, your device will start scanning for nearby Bluetooth devices.
Step 2: Put Your Headphones in Pairing Mode
Once your device starts scanning for Bluetooth devices, you need to put your Muze Bluetooth headphones in pairing mode. To do this, press and hold the power button on your headphones until the LED light starts flashing. This indicates that your headphones are now in pairing mode and ready to be connected to your device.
Step 3: Select Your Headphones from the List of Available Devices
Next, you need to select your Muze Bluetooth headphones from the list of available devices on your device. The name of your headphones should appear on the list of available devices. Once you have selected your headphones, your device will start connecting to them.
Step 4: Enter the Passcode
After you have selected your headphones, your device may prompt you to enter a passcode to complete the connection process. The passcode for Muze Bluetooth headphones is usually “0000” or “1234”. Once you have entered the passcode, your device should be successfully connected to your headphones.
Troubleshooting
1. Headphones Not Found
If your device is not able to find your Muze Bluetooth headphones, make sure that your headphones are in pairing mode and within range of your device. Also, try turning off Bluetooth on your device and then turning it back on again.
2. Connection Issues
If you experience connection issues, try resetting your headphones and your device. You can also try disconnecting and reconnecting your headphones to your device.
3. Poor Sound Quality
If you are experiencing poor sound quality, make sure that your headphones are fully charged and within range of your device. Also, try adjusting the volume on your device and your headphones to ensure that they are at an appropriate level.

How do I turn on my Muze Bluetooth headphones?
To turn on your Muze Bluetooth headphones, press and hold the power button for about 3 seconds. The LED light will start flashing, indicating that the headphones are in pairing mode.
If you have already paired your headphones with a device before, they will automatically connect to that device when turned on. If not, make sure that Bluetooth is enabled on your device and search for available Bluetooth devices.
How do I put my Muze Bluetooth headphones in pairing mode?
To put your Muze Bluetooth headphones in pairing mode, make sure they are turned off. Then, press and hold the power button for about 5 seconds, until the LED light starts flashing red and blue.
Once the headphones are in pairing mode, you can connect them to your device by going to your device’s Bluetooth settings and selecting the Muze headphones from the list of available devices.
How do I reset my Muze Bluetooth headphones?
If you are experiencing issues with your Muze Bluetooth headphones, you may need to reset them. To do this, press and hold both the volume up and volume down buttons for about 5 seconds, until the LED light flashes red and blue.
Once the headphones have been reset, you will need to put them in pairing mode again and reconnect them to your device.
How do I charge my Muze Bluetooth headphones?
To charge your Muze Bluetooth headphones, use the included USB charging cable to connect them to a power source, such as a computer or wall adapter.
The LED light on the headphones will turn red while they are charging, and will turn off once they are fully charged. It takes about 2 hours to fully charge the headphones, and they will provide up to 20 hours of playback time on a single charge.
How do I control the volume on my Muze Bluetooth headphones?
To control the volume on your Muze Bluetooth headphones, use the volume up and volume down buttons located on the side of the headphones.
You can also pause or play music, skip tracks, and answer or end phone calls using the buttons on the headphones. Refer to the user manual for specific instructions on how to use these features.
